Yeast works best in lukewarm water, between 105-115 degrees Fahrenheit.
Yeast is a living organism that is used in baking to help dough rise. It is important to ensure that the water temperature used when activating the yeast is not too hot or too cold. The ideal temperature for activating yeast is between 105-115 degrees Fahrenheit, or lukewarm.
Too cold and the yeast will not activate and your dough may not rise properly. Too hot and you can kill the yeast. It is best to measure the temperature of the water with a thermometer or by feel before adding the yeast. Doing this will help ensure you get the best results from your baking.

To help the yeast rise, add sugar, honey, or molasses to the water.
Yeast is a living organism that needs a few specific ingredients to thrive and multiply. To help the yeast rise, adding sugar, honey, or molasses to warm water is an effective way to give it the energy it needs. The sugar provides food for the yeast, allowing it to reproduce and create carbon dioxide bubbles that make the dough rise.
Honey and molasses are also great sources of energy for yeast, as they contain more complex sugars than simple table sugar. All three of these ingredients should be added in small amounts to the warm water before adding the yeast, usually about a teaspoon of sugar or honey, or two teaspoons of molasses per cup of warm water. Adding sugar, honey, or molasses to water is an important part of any recipe that calls for active dry yeast, and will help ensure that the yeast will rise as desired.

Use warm water if you are using active dry yeast, and cool water if you are using instant yeast.
When using yeast for baking, the type of water used is an important factor to consider. Active dry yeast should be used with warm water, usually between 105-115°F (40-46°C). Temperature that is too hot can kill the yeast while temperatures that are too cold will not activate it.
On the other hand, when using instant yeast, cool water should be used, between 70-80°F (21-27°C). This temperature is just right for the yeast to remain active and start fermenting. The exact temperature of the water should be checked with a kitchen thermometer for optimal results. Too much or too little water can also affect the quality of the bake, so it is important to measure and use the exact amount of water specified in the recipe.

If the water is too hot, it will kill the yeast.
Yeast is a key ingredient in many baking recipes, as it helps the dough to rise. When yeast is added to dough, it begins to feed on the sugars present and produces carbon dioxide gas as a byproduct. This gas is what causes the dough to expand and become fluffy.
However, if the water used to activate the yeast is too hot, it can kill the yeast, rendering it ineffective. Water that is too hot can also cause the proteins in the dough to coagulate, resulting in a dense, heavy texture. Generally speaking, water temperature should be between 105-115 degrees Fahrenheit when activating yeast. Any hotter than that and the yeast will be killed. To ensure that the yeast is still active, use a thermometer to check the temperature of the water before adding it to the dough.

Don't forget to activate the yeast before adding it to the bread machine.
Yeast is a critical ingredient in making bread, and it is important to make sure it is activated before adding it to the bread machine. To activate yeast, you will need to combine it with warm water (no hotter than 115°F) and a small amount of sugar. Let the mixture sit for approximately 10 minutes and then check to see if the yeast has started to foam.
If it has, it is ready to use. If not, the yeast may be too old or the water may have been too hot, and you will need to start again with new yeast. Once the yeast is activated, it can be added to the other dry ingredients in the bread machine, along with the wet ingredients, and the bread can be made according to the instructions.
